MySQL是一種常用的關系型數據庫管理系統,但是在使用它時,有時候可能會出現殘留痕跡。這些殘留痕跡可能會影響到數據庫的正常運作,因此我們需要對這些痕跡進行清理。
常見的 MySQL 殘留痕跡包括以下幾種: 1.未正確卸載 MySQL 而遺留下來的文件和目錄; 2.已卸載 MySQL 但沒有徹底清除配置文件和數據文件; 3.在 MySQL 的安裝目錄下創建 MySQL 數據目錄,導致 MySQL 認為該目錄是數據目錄而導致問題。
針對以上不同的痕跡,我們需要采取不同的清理方式:
1.如果沒有正確卸載 MySQL,可以使用以下命令移除 MySQL 服務: $ sudo apt-get remove mysql-server $ sudo apt-get autoremove 然后在執行以下命令徹底清除 MySQL 相關文件和目錄: $ sudo rm -rf /etc/mysql/ $ sudo rm -rf /var/lib/mysql/ $ sudo rm -rf /var/log/mysql/ $ sudo rm -rf /usr/share/mysql/ $ sudo rm -rf /usr/bin/mysql/ $ sudo rm -rf /usr/lib/mysql/ 2.如果已卸載 MySQL 但沒有徹底清除配置文件和數據文件,可以使用以下命令清理: $ sudo rm /etc/mysql/my.cnf $ sudo rm -rf /var/lib/mysql/* $ sudo rm -rf /var/log/mysql/* $ sudo apt-get autoremove $ sudo apt-get remove mysql* 3.如果在 MySQL 的安裝目錄下創建 MySQL 數據目錄,可以使用以下命令清除: $ sudo rm -rf /usr/local/mysql/
因此,查找和清除 MySQL 殘留痕跡是確保數據庫正常運行的關鍵步驟。